说明:最全专利文库
(19)国家知识产权局 (12)发明 专利申请 (10)申请公布号 (43)申请公布日 (21)申请 号 202211125640.6 (22)申请日 2022.09.16 (71)申请人 武汉虹信技 术服务有限责任公司 地址 430205 湖北省武汉市江夏区藏龙岛 科技园谭湖2路1号虹信无线通信产业 园2号楼4楼 (72)发明人 曾华 黄晓艳 钟卫为  (74)专利代理 机构 武汉东喻专利代理事务所 (普通合伙) 42224 专利代理师 张英 (51)Int.Cl. G06F 8/20(2018.01) G06F 9/451(2018.01) (54)发明名称 一种可视化UI界面 生成方法及系统 (57)摘要 本发明涉及可视化界面技术领域, 尤其涉及 一种可视化UI界面生成方法及系统, 方法包括: 将用户界面网格化处理, 获取每个网格的坐标; 为用户界面中的不同菜单栏生成多个不同的标 记点, 将每个标记点附着至第一位置周围 的网格 点, 获取标记点的第一坐标; 获取用户界面在标 记点上的交互指令, 之后将每个标记 点附着至第 二位置周围的网格点, 获取第二位置的网格点的 坐标, 覆盖该标记点的位置坐标, 获取标记点的 实时位置。 本发明通过对用户界面进行网格化, 并为每个网格点定位, 通过设置网格点吸附模 块, 能够将用户界面菜单栏上的标记 点吸附到网 格点上, 实现对菜单栏位置的调节, 使得用户界 面更加界面化与人性化, 便于用户跟随自己的操 作习惯进行使用。 权利要求书1页 说明书6页 附图1页 CN 115373644 A 2022.11.22 CN 115373644 A 1.一种可视化UI界面 生成方法, 其特 征在于, 包括: 将用户界面网格化处 理, 获取每 个网格的坐标; 为所述用户界面中的不同菜单栏生成多个不同的标记点, 将每个标记点附着至第 一位 置周围的网格点, 获取 标记点的第一 坐标; 获取用户界面在标记点上的交互指令, 之后将每个标记点附着至第 二位置周围的网格 点, 获取所述第二位置的网格点的坐标, 覆盖该标记点的位置坐标, 获取标记点的实时位 置。 2.根据权利要求1所述的一种可视化UI界面 生成方法, 其特 征在于, 包括: 获取用户显示设备的分辨率, 将网格化生成的网格模型的分辨率调 整为所述显示设备 的分辨率。 3.根据权利要求1所述的一种可视化UI界面 生成方法, 其特 征在于, 包括: 捕捉所述菜单栏上的所述标记点在所述网格界面上的移动轨迹, 并获取标记点的位置 坐标。 4.根据权利要求3所述的一种可视化UI界面 生成方法, 其特 征在于, 包括: 在所述第一位置, 获取当前标记点的初始位置坐标, 将标记点与距离最近的网格点匹 配, 将初始位置坐标替换为对应网格点的坐标; 在所述第二位置, 获取当前标记点的第二位置坐标, 将标记点与距离最近的网格点匹 配, 将第二 位置坐标替换为对应网格点的坐标。 5.根据权利要求 4所述的一种可视化UI界面 生成方法, 其特 征在于, 包括: 获取所述标记点移动至所述第 二位置之前, 获取与所述标记点在实时位置上匹配的多 个网格点, 分别将每个网格点的坐标替换为对应的网格点的坐标, 生成所述标记点从所述 第一位置移动至所述第二 位置的轨 迹。 6.根据权利要求1 ‑5任一项所述的一种可视化UI界面 生成方法, 其特 征在于, 包括: 将所述用户界面网格化处 理后, 获取的网格化模型为矢量图。 7.一种可视化UI界面 生成系统, 其特 征在于, 包括: 网格化模块, 用于将用户界面网格化处 理, 获取每 个网格的坐标; 标记点生成模块, 用于为所述用户界面中的不同菜单栏 生成多个不同的标记点; 网格点吸附模块, 用于将每个标记点附着至第一位置周围的网格点, 获取标记点的第 一坐标; 坐标匹配模块, 用于获取用户界面在标记点上的交互指令, 之后将每个标记点附着至 第二位置周围的网格点, 获取所述第二位置的网格点的坐标, 覆盖该标记点的位置坐标, 获 取标记点的实时位置 。 8.一种电子设备, 包括存储器、 处理器及存储在所述存储器上并可在所述处理器上运 行的计算机程序, 其特征在于, 所述处理器执行所述程序时实现如权利要求1至6任一项所 述可视化UI界面 生成方法的步骤。 9.一种非暂态计算机可读存储介质, 其上存储有计算机程序, 其特征在于, 所述计算机 程序被处 理器执行时实现如权利要求1至 6任一项所述可视化UI界面 生成方法的步骤。权 利 要 求 书 1/1 页 2 CN 115373644 A 2一种可视化UI界面生成方 法及系统 技术领域 [0001]本发明涉及可视化界面 技术领域, 尤其涉及一种可视化UI界面 生成方法及系统。 背景技术 [0002]用户界面是指对软件的人机交互、 操作逻辑、 界面美观的整体设计。 好的UI设计不 仅是让软件变得有个性有品味, 还要让软件的操作变得舒适、 简单、 自由、 充分体现软件的 定位和特点。 UI设计又称界面设计, 是指对软件的人机交互、 操作逻辑、 界面美观的整体设 计。 [0003]目前的可视化页面生成技术还有着如下的缺点: 开发的可视化页面面向众多不同 的行业, 使得用户需要花费更多时间来自行调整界面的显示属 性, 会影响到用户的使用效 率; 不管是APP端的用户界面还是网页端的用户界面, 其上各个菜单栏的位置是固定不变 的, 用户无法根据自己的使用习惯对菜 单栏的位置进 行调节, 降低了用户界面的个性化, 同 时也不利于用户的使用。 发明内容 [0004]本发明提供一种可视化UI界面生成方法及系统, 用以解决上述现有技术的缺陷, 实现对菜单栏位置的调节, 能根据用户的使用随意调整UI的位置, 并能根据用户对标记 点、 菜单栏的操作指令及时响应至各类尺寸的显示设备, 兼容 性好。 [0005]本发明提供一种可视化UI界面 生成方法, 包括 步骤: [0006]将用户界面网格化处 理, 获取每 个网格的坐标; [0007]为所述用户界面中的不同菜单栏生成多个不同的标记点, 将每个标记点附着至第 一位置周围的网格点, 获取 标记点的第一 坐标; [0008]获取用户界面在标记点上的交互指令, 之后将每个标记点附着至第二位置周围的 网格点, 获取所述第二位置的网格点的坐标, 覆盖该标记点的位置坐标, 获取标记点的实时 位置。 [0009]根据本发明提供的一种可视化UI界面 生成方法, 进一 步包括: [0010]获取用户显示设备的分辨率, 将网格化生成的网格模型的分辨率调整为所述显示 设备的分辨 率。 [0011]根据本发明提供的一种可视化UI界面 生成方法, 进一 步包括: [0012]捕捉所述菜单栏上的所述标记点在所述网格界面上的移动轨迹, 并获取标记点的 位置坐标。 [0013]根据本发明提供的一种可视化UI界面 生成方法, 进一 步包括: [0014]在所述第一位置, 获取当前标记点的初始位置坐标, 将标记点与距离最近 的网格 点匹配, 将初始位置坐标替换为对应网格点的坐标; [0015]在所述第二位置, 获取当前标记点的第二位置坐标, 将标记点与距离最近 的网格 点匹配, 将第二 位置坐标替换为对应网格点的坐标。说 明 书 1/6 页 3 CN 115373644 A 3

.PDF文档 专利 一种可视化UI界面生成方法及系统

文档预览
中文文档 9 页 50 下载 1000 浏览 0 评论 309 收藏 3.0分
温馨提示:本文档共9页,可预览 3 页,如浏览全部内容或当前文档出现乱码,可开通会员下载原始文档
专利 一种可视化UI界面生成方法及系统 第 1 页 专利 一种可视化UI界面生成方法及系统 第 2 页 专利 一种可视化UI界面生成方法及系统 第 3 页
下载文档到电脑,方便使用
本文档由 人生无常 于 2024-03-18 17:06:20上传分享
站内资源均来自网友分享或网络收集整理,若无意中侵犯到您的权利,敬请联系我们微信(点击查看客服),我们将及时删除相关资源。